We are talking infection fatality rate not infection rate. Infection fatality rate is number of people who die after they are infected. That's one of the most important numbers and it can be estimated. It's different from case fatality rate. Number of people diagnosed with COVID-19 who die. You started your argument trying to argue based on your understanding of what the infection fatality rate is.
Nobody knows the true infection fatality rate. Probably the best estimate we can make is from South Korea where they have done a pretty good job of testing everyone infected. There the infection fatality rate is 1.8% and rising as the cases age out and people in the ICUs die.
It can be estimated with increasing accuracy.
> There the infection fatality rate is 1.8% and rising as the cases age out and people in the ICUs die.
You continue citing case fatality rate (CFR) numbers and call them infection fatality rate numbers (IFR). Can you please go back to your sources and read what they say. I bet they are case fatality rates. In South Korea one IFR estimates put the number around 0.4 and 0.7%.
Here are some IFR estimates:
1. Estimating the infection fatality rate of COVID 19 in South Korea by using time series correlations https://figshare.com/articles/Estimating_the_infection_fatal...
2. Estimating the infection and case fatality ratio for coronavirus disease (COVID-19) using age-adjusted data from the outbreak on the Diamond Princess cruise ship, February 2020 https://www.eurosurveillance.org/content/10.2807/1560-7917.E...
3. Using early data to estimate the actual infection fatality ratio from COVID-19 in France https://www.medrxiv.org/content/10.1101/2020.03.22.20040915v...
4. Robust Estimation of Infection Fatality Rates during the Early Phase of a Pandemic https://www.medrxiv.org/content/10.1101/2020.04.08.20057729v...

Or until something like 95% of population has been infected and we know for sure that those who already had the disease can not spread it anymore.
What about people born after that point? As immune people die over time from other causes, and as people are born without immunity, the percent of the population with immunity from having had it falls. Non-vaccine acquired herd immunity is temporary.
